What is a Unified EHR and Billing Platform?

A unified EHR and billing platform is a software system that includes both electronic health records (EHR) and billing functionality. This type of system can be extremely helpful for substance abuse treatment centers because it allows you to manage both patient records and billing in one place. You can also use substance use EHR software to manage other aspects of your business, such as scheduling and marketing. It involves having a central database where all your patient information is stored. From this database, you can generate reports, track outcomes, and much more. In general, a unified EHR and billing platform will make your life a lot easier and help you run your substance abuse treatment center more efficiently.

Why Do You Need a Unified EHR and Billing Platform?

There are many reasons why your substance abuse treatment center needs a unified EHR and billing platform. Perhaps the most important reason is that it will help you keep accurate records. When all of your patient information is stored in one place, it is much easier to keep track of. You will also be able to generate reports more easily and get a better overview of your patient’s progress.

Another reason why you need a unified EHR and billing platform is that it can save you a lot of time and money. If you are currently using separate systems for your EHR and billing, then you know how time-consuming and expensive it can be to maintain both. A unified system will help you save money on things like licenses, support, and training. It will also make it easier for your staff to use the system, which will save you time in the long run.

Finally, a unified EHR and billing platform can help you improve the quality of care that you provide. When you have all of your patient information in one place, it is easier to spot trends and identify areas where care can be improved. You can also use the system to track outcomes and measure the success of your treatment programs.
